Abstract

Controllable rotor systems are the innovation of the drilling tool enabling to manage the well path decreasing failure and complication risk. The rig in this system moves by set path with continuous motion of drill string. The rotation of drilling tool provides the effective well cleaning, reduces the drilling tool sticking and allows drilling deep wells and those with complicated profile compared to the drilling with bottomhole engine. The most complicated circumstance for obtaining required drilling rate is the maintenance of enough load transmission from the earth surface to the rig regardless the boundary conditions between the well and drilling tool.
